How to| 插入文件路径

不论您是进行导入、导出还是其它操作,Wolfram 系统必须首先知道在哪里查找您计算机上的文件,然后才能使用它们. 存在许多供 Wolfram 系统自动搜索文件的目录. 但是,当您要使用的文件不在这些目录中时,您必须指定它们的位置. Wolfram 系统提供多种便捷的方式来执行此操作.

Video Database Error (404) : Video does not exist

一种告诉 Wolfram 系统在哪里查找文件或目录的方法是键入完整的路径.

例如,通过键入完整的文件路径导入该图像的尺寸信息:

In[1]:=
Click for copyable input
Out[1]=

该文件路径的各部分由符号 分开,该符号在字符串中代表 Windows 操作系统中的文件分隔符 .

如果您不能立即知道完整的文件路径,您可以使用 插入 文件路径 菜单项. 这样您可以使用计算机的文件系统浏览器选择文件:

使用该菜单项时,您必须选择一个单独的文件. Mathematica 不允许您选择一个文件夹. 如要插入一个文件夹路径,需要选择该文件夹中的一个文件,然后从路径中手动删除这个文件名.

另外,您也可以将 DirectoryName 用于文件名:

In[2]:=
Click for copyable input
Out[2]=

您还可以通过组合使用拖放与快捷键来插入一个文件夹或文件的路径.

在 Mac OS X 中, 先定位到该文件或文件夹. 单击并将它拖放到一个笔记本上,然后按住 Option 键的同时释放鼠标按钮:

在 Windows 中的操作大体相同,不同的是按住 Ctrl+ Shift 键的同时释放鼠标按钮. 光标将发生变化,指示在释放鼠标按钮时,将插入一个路径:

在 Linux 中,插入一个文件或文件夹路径时,与鼠标拖放共同使用的键盘快捷键是 Shift. 然而,取决于您的文件管理程序,您可能不会看到光标发生变化. 即使光标不会变化,按住 Shift 的同时拖放文件或文件夹将仍然会插入正确的路径.

在 Windows 和 Linux 中,通过拖放插入一个文件或文件夹的操作对 Mathematica 8 之前的版本无效.

如要了解如何用编程方式创建文件和目录路径,请参阅 How to: 在 Wolfram 语言中输入与构建文件名.

关于如何识别与改变 Wolfram 系统在查找文件时自动使用的目录,请参阅 How to: 定位并使用文件.